Aerospace Accumulator Market size, Trends analysis and Forecast by 2033

According to the latest report published by Data Bridge Market Research, the Aerospace Accumulator Market

  • The global aerospace accumulator market size was valued at USD 9.89 billion in 2025 and is expected to reach USD 13.02 billion by 2033, at a CAGR of 3.50% during the forecast period.

The global aerospace accumulator market is witnessing significant growth due to the increasing demand for lightweight and high-performance aerospace components. One of the key trends in the market is the growing emphasis on the development of advanced materials for accumulators to improve efficiency and durability. Manufacturers are investing in research and development to introduce innovative solutions that meet the evolving requirements of the aerospace industry. The demand for hydraulic accumulators is expected to remain high, driven by the need for reliable energy storage systems in various aircraft applications. Pneumatic accumulators are also gaining traction, particularly in commercial and military aircraft, where rapid energy release is crucial for certain operations.

In terms of materials, carbon composite accumulators are experiencing a surge in demand due to their superior strength-to-weight ratio and corrosion resistance properties. Carbon composite materials offer significant weight savings compared to traditional steel accumulators, making them ideal for aerospace applications where weight reduction is critical for fuel efficiency and overall performance. Hybrid accumulators, which combine the benefits of different materials, are also being increasingly adopted to enhance the structural integrity and performance of aerospace systems. These advancements in materials technology are driving the market towards more sustainable and cost-effective solutions.
